ABSTRACT:
The invention provides isolated polypeptide and nucleic acid sequences derived fromStreptococcus pneumoniaethat are useful in diagnosis and therapy of pathological conditions; antibodies against the polypeptides; and methods for the production of the polypeptides. The invention also provides methods for the detection, prevention and treatment of pathological conditions resulting from bacterial infection.
